Elimina i volumi eliminati
Puoi usare il PurgeDeletedVolumes Metodo per eliminare immediatamente e definitivamente i volumi eliminati; è possibile utilizzare questo metodo per eliminare fino a 500 volumi contemporaneamente.
È necessario eliminare i volumi utilizzando DeleteVolumes prima che possano essere eliminati. I volumi vengono eliminati automaticamente dopo un certo periodo di tempo, pertanto in genere non è necessario utilizzare questo metodo.
|
|
Se si eliminano contemporaneamente un gran numero di volumi o se ai volumi eliminati sono associati molti snapshot, il metodo potrebbe non funzionare e restituire l'errore "xDBConnectionLoss". In tal caso, riprovare la chiamata al metodo con un numero inferiore di volumi. |
Parametri
Questo metodo ha i seguenti parametri di input:
| Nome | Descrizione | Tipo | Valore predefinito | Necessario |
|---|---|---|---|---|
volumeID |
Un elenco di volumi ID da eliminare dal sistema. |
array di interi |
NO |
NO |
ID account |
Un elenco di ID account. Tutti i volumi di tutti gli account specificati vengono eliminati dal sistema. |
array di interi |
NO |
NO |
volumeAccessGroupIDs |
Un elenco di volumeAccessGroupID. Tutti i volumi di tutti i gruppi di accesso ai volumi specificati vengono eliminati dal sistema. |
array di interi |
NO |
NO |
Nota: è possibile specificare solo uno dei parametri sopra indicati per ogni chiamata al metodo. Specificarne più di uno, o nessuno, genera un errore.
Valori di ritorno
Questo metodo non ha valori di ritorno.
Richiedi esempio
Le richieste per questo metodo sono simili al seguente esempio:
{
"method": "PurgeDeletedVolumes",
"params": {
"accountIDs" : [1, 2, 3]
},
"id" : 1
}
Esempio di risposta
Questo metodo restituisce una risposta simile al seguente esempio:
{
"id" : 1,
"result": {}
}
Nuovo dalla versione
9,6